Mobile Broadband or Wireless Wide Area Network (WWAN)

Removing the Mini-Card

1.Follow the instructions in Before You Begin.

2.Remove the battery (see Removing the Battery).

3.Remove the keyboard (see Removing the Keyboard).

4.Disconnect the antenna cables from the Mini-Card.

5.Release the Mini-Card by removing the two screws that secure the Mini-Card to the system board.

6.Lift the Mini-Card out of its system board connector.

CAUTION: When the Mini-Card is not in the computer, store it in protective antistatic packaging (see "Protecting Against Electrostatic Discharge" in the safety instructions that shipped with your computer).

Replacing the Mini-Card

CAUTION: The connectors are keyed to ensure correct insertion. If you feel resistance, check the connectors on the card and on the system board, and realign the card.

CAUTION: To avoid damage to the Mini-Card, never place cables under the card.

The Dell PP19S, also known as the Dell Mini 10, is a compact and versatile netbook designed for portable computing. With the model number R891K and associated part code 0R891KA01, this device offers users a blend of functionality and portability, making it an ideal choice for those who need computing power on the go. The Mini 10 is particularly geared towards users who prioritize lightness and ease of use without sacrificing essential features.

One of the standout characteristics of the Dell Mini 10 is its sleek and lightweight design. Weighing around 2.5 pounds, this netbook is easy to carry in a backpack or briefcase, making it perfect for students and professionals alike. The device features a 10.1-inch display with a resolution of 1366 x 768 pixels, providing clear visuals that enhance both productivity and entertainment.

The Dell PP19S is powered by an Intel Atom processor, which, while not as powerful as contemporary higher-end CPUs, offers sufficient performance for basic tasks like web browsing, document editing, and media playback. The energy-efficient design of the Atom processor also contributes to the Mini 10's impressive battery life, allowing users to work unplugged for extended periods.

Storage options for the Dell Mini 10 typically include a 160GB or 250GB hard drive, providing ample space for files, applications, and media. Additionally, the device is equipped with 1GB of RAM, enabling smooth multitasking for lightweight applications. For connectivity, the Mini 10 comes with built-in Wi-Fi and optional Bluetooth, ensuring users can easily stay connected to the internet and other devices.

Another notable feature is the inclusion of multiple USB ports, an SD card reader, and a webcam, catering to various user needs. The integrated Intel Graphics Media Accelerator enhances the visual experience, making it suitable for casual gaming and streaming.
